Controversial Finish Crowns New Champion On WWE NXT

WWE NXT logo over blurred North American Title

Tonight’s show is set to have huge implications in the title picture in NXT as a huge title match kicked off tonight’s edition of WWE NXT live from the Performance Center in Orlando, Florida.

While Blake Monroe defended her NXT Women’s North American Championship against Thea Hail, the number one contender for the NXT Championship will also be decided in the main event tonight.

Thea Hail earned a shot at the Women’s North American Championship as she managed to tap Monroe out last week during her open challenge but the match was never officially started. It was later made official for this week by the General Manage, Ava.

Thea Hail wins the NXT Women’s North American Championship

The champion started the match on the front foot and dominated the early stages of the match. She targeted Thea’s left arm and proceeded to inflict damage on the arm, which allowed her to remain in control.

Thea Hail managed to dig deep and recover from the beating that Moroe issued on her. She used the momentum in her favour and hit her with a Springboard Senton to pin Monroe for the title.

However, it seemed that Monroe had kicked out just before the referee hit the three count but he went for the bell and crowned Thea Hail the new NXT Women’s North American Champion. The controversial finish left everyone from the competitors and the commentators confused but Thea Hail was crowned the champion.
